About this role
As a RN Case Manager PRN, your voice to influence patient care is valued and empowered at every turn –whether through open, collaborative relationships with your direct manager or more formal opportunities through hospital councils and national nursing initiatives. You'll help shape decisions that elevate both patient outcomes and the future of nursing. This is a PRN Day Shift position, hours are typically 8:00am-4:30pm, and will help to cover both weekdays and weekends.
Our RN Case Managers raise the bar by providing clinical expertise and the highest quality care in the most compassionate way. The RN Case Manager is responsible for promoting patient-centered care by coordinating the plan of care for the patient stay, managing the length of stay, ensuring appropriate resource management, and developing a safe appropriate discharge plan in collaboration with the multidisciplinary team.

Requirements
- Registered Nurse with current TX state license required
- Associate Degree in Nursing or Nursing diploma required
- Bachelor's Degree in Nursing preferred
- 3+ years of clinical hospital nursing experience required OR 2+ years experience in case management required
- Certification in case management preferred
- InterQual experience preferred
- Weekends as needed

McKinney blends small-town charm with big-city access, sitting about 30 miles north of Dallas. Its tree-lined historic downtown square features local shops and eateries, while master-planned communities ring the outer edges. A booming Collin County hub that gives nurses suburban comfort with easy DFW metro access.
